Scepter Golf Club is an 18-hole golf course in Sun City Center, FL with a par of 72. It offers 8 tee sets: blue (6,647 yards, slope 126, rating 72.7), white (5,976 yards, slope 119, rating 69.7), white/green (5,727 yards, slope 113, rating 68.5), green (5,434 yards, slope 109, rating 67.1), red (5,093 yards, slope 106, rating 65.6), yellow (4,810 yards, slope 104, rating 64), yellow/orange (3,935 yards, slope 99, rating 60.8), orange (3,485 yards, slope 95, rating 59.5). The hardest hole is #5, a par 4 playing 291 yards from the first tee.
